Onboarding: Cyclestack rebalancing tool — support basics.

Cyclestack moves bikes between docks based on hourly demand forecasts for the Morrowvale network. Most tickets concern stale dock counts; ask riders for the dock name, then trigger a manual resync from the ops panel. Access to the ops panel requires the team vault, and first-time logins will prompt for its recovery passphrase, shown immediately below.

vault phrase of tajop-haduf = holath-brivan-wenax

## Break-Glass Access: Datewise Locale Service

If the Datewise locale pipeline fails during a release cut, localized date formats fall back to ISO defaults, which blocks sign-off in several markets. Break-glass access lets the release manager push corrected CLDR-style format tables directly to the Fennwick edge cache, bypassing the normal review queue. Use only when the localization team is unreachable. Log the incident in the Datewise channel afterward. To unlock the break-glass console, enter the passphrase below.

unlock words, hahip-baduf: holwyn-istath-julvan

## Action Item: Loyalty ledger reconciliation backoff

New folks, context: during the Pinecrest incident, the Stampwise loyalty-points ledger double-applied retries because our reconciliation job hammered the write path with no backoff. Points balances drifted for about two hours. Fix is a bounded retry schedule plus a reconciliation batch cap, now baked into the job config. The agreed tuning constants are below.

tuning constants:
QUOTAS = {
    "druwyn": 5,
    "holix": 5,
    "zorath": 5,
    "holwyn": 10,
}

RESTRICTED WIKI — Managers Only

Pearmont Utilities: Legacy Pricing Adjustment

From next April, customers on the legacy Silverbrook tariff move to the standard rate, an average increase of 8%. Notification letters go out in two waves; frontline scripts and objection-handling guides are linked on the Corven intranet page. Heads of department should expect elevated contact volumes for roughly six weeks and staff accordingly. Hardship cases route to Ms. Ellacott's team. The commercial reasoning behind the timing is recorded below.

confidential, bahap-bajog: Zorethix Works is in early talks to buy Kelethox Foods for about $30.7 million. The Ralvan launch date is September 19, and nothing goes to the press before then.